Rabindra Mishra joined (RPP) Rastriya Prajatantra Party

Rabindra Mishra, who emerged from media work and entered the direct politics of Nepal through the Sajha Party, today joined the Rastriya Prajatantra Party RPP after resigning from the Bibeksheel Sajha Party a few days ago.

Mishra joined the RPP with the post of Senior Vice President during a program held today at the National Assembly House.

It is said that along with Mishra, more than a dozen leaders and workers, including Bibeksheel Sajha’s spokesperson Sharad Pathak, Bagmati provincial coordinator and executive committee member Ujwalkrishna Shrestha, are also preparing to join RPP.
